Damon, fifties
Once, a very long time ago, I had a good job, a loving family, and a white picket fence. I started my own business, worked hard, and collected the toys that the wealthy haveâa boat, a mansion, a few Harleys. I worried about the things you probably worry aboutâthe stress of work every Monday morning, the bills that kept piling up, and the fact that the more we had, the more it didnât quite seem like enough.
Then, following the financial crisis in 2007â2008, I lost my business, my family, and my home. I lost everything.
You know what they say: when it rains, it pours. The same week that our business went under, my wifeâs younger sister, Sarah, was killed in a tragic car accident. She was dating a naval cadet who was set to graduate the next day. They were on their way back from the ball before graduation when he lost control of the car and crashed. Sarah died in the wreck. He was able to get to the highway to flag down help, but he was struck and killed instantly. I was depressed, and we needed money and a car; I was looking for a job, any job, to pay off our bills and debt. I worked anything I could get my hands onâlawn care, mechanic, pawnshopâand drove a dead womanâs car around all day.
After months of trying to dig myself out of a financial hole, I gave up and started making some very bad decisions. For one, I started sleeping with my landlord. She was married, and her husband was a cop. But she was attractive, and she made herself very available, so it was easy to make irrational choices. The first time, she asked me to help her move some things into her beach house. She came on to meâshe was very aggressiveâand I didnât resist. She wanted to leave the window open so that people could watch us. I let her do whatever she wanted. She was exciting and made me feel alive, and for those few hours that we were together, I wasnât focusing on my problems. After fourteen years of sobriety, she got me drinking again. We started going to bars every night. Twice, I rode the Harley to Key West and, another time, to Bourbon Street in New Orleansâdrunk and high. My wife found out eventually, of course, and she left me.
I donât blame her. Things got really hard for us, and I wasnât a partner to her. I didnât deal with it well. We needed a steady hand at the helm, and I was out cavorting. I thought it was situational depression, but the doctors diagnosed me with bipolar disorder, too, and put me on medication. I was very active and social during this time, but I also felt dulled, lethargic, and sleepy.
